Best Beef Tenderloin with Creamy Mustard Sauce

The most amazing (and easiest!) melt-in-your-mouth beef tenderloin recipe using the simplest ingredients!

Ingredients
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h thyme leaves
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 3-pound beef tenderloin, trimmed and tied into 2-inch sections
  • 2 teaspoons kosher salt
  • 2 teaspoons ground black pepper
  • For the creamy mustard sauce
  • ¾ cup sour cream
  • ¼ cup whole grain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on horseradish, or more, to taste
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h chives
  •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Directions
  1. To make the creamy mustard sauce, whisk together sour cream, Dijon, horseradish and chives; season with salt and pepper, to taste. Set aside.
  2. Preheat oven to 500 degrees F.
  3. In a small bowl, combine vegetable oil, thyme and garlic.
  4. Let tenderloin stand at room temperature 1 hour. Using paper towels, pat tenderloin dry. Drizzle with vegetable oil mixture; season with salt and pepper, gently pressing to adhere.
  5. Place tenderloin on a rack in a shallow roasting pan. Place into oven and roast for 15 minutes.
  6. Reduce oven temperature to 375 degrees F. Continue roasting until it reaches an internal temperature of 130-135 degrees F for medium-rare, about 15-25 minutes, or until desired doneness. Let rest 10 minutes before slicing.
  7. Serve immediately with creamy mustard sauce.
